    What is Your Life Expantancy?

    So how long will you live? Scroll down to Appendix C, Table I in the link below and look it up.

    This is the IRS's life expantancy table. The government knows how long you're going to live and how much tax they can get out of you.

    Look up your age and then your remaining life expantancy is in the column next to it. So for example; I'll be 57 in a few weeks and that means I get to live to 84.9 years(57+27.9 = 84.9).


    http://www.irs.gov/publications/p590/ar02.html

    Excerpt:
    Table I
    (Single Life Expectancy)
    (For Use by Beneficiaries)
    Age Life Expectancy Age Life Expectancy
    56 28.7 84 8.1
    57 27.9 85 7.6
    58 27.0 86 7.1
